Africa-Press – South-Africa. This follows the resignation of Zizi Kodwa, who is accused of corruption. President Cyril Ramaphosa has appointed an acting Sports, Arts and Culture Minister, following Zizi Kodwa’s resignation this week.
Minister in the Presidency for Planning, Monitoring and Evaluation, Maropene Ramokgopa will step into the portfolio, for now. Corruption-accused Kodwa resigned from public office with immediate effect on Wednesday.
He is accused of accepting bribes from tech giant EOH between 2015 and 2016. “The President has appointed Minister Maropene Ramokgopa to act as the Minister until a permanent appointment is made under the new seventh administration,” said spokesperson in The Presidency Vincent Magwenya.
